Account Recovery — Pagewright Static Builds

If a customer loses access to their Pagewright dashboard, incremental rebuilds of their static site will continue from the last known-good deploy, so no content is lost during recovery. Confirm the customer's last rebuild timestamp in the Orlin console, then initiate the recovery flow from the admin panel. Do not trigger a full rebuild until access is restored. Unlocking the recovery flow requires the passphrase below.

recovery phrase for yadup-taguf: wenael-quenox-kelix

# Legacy ORM shim for the Bryntower billing schema.
# This module exists only while we migrate off HallowDB mappers.
# Do not add new query paths here; use the Ferrow repository layer.
# Connection pooling mirrors the old defaults to keep replica lag
# predictable during cutover. Remove this file once migration
# phase three completes. Pool and timeout constants follow.

limits module of tawip-yahag:
QUOTAS = {
    "wenwyn": 1,
    "oliwyn": 10,
}

Runbook: GrowMaster sensor drift. When humidity readings from the east-bay probes diverge more than 4% from the reference sensor, the controller begins overcorrecting the misting cycle. First verify the drift-compensation job ran overnight; if it did and drift persists, recalibrate via the maintenance endpoint and restart the aggregator. For review, note that the compensation thresholds live in the service config, reproduced here.

settings of tagef-bawif:
DRUIX_HOST=druix.zemvarlabs.internal
DRUIX_PORT=8000